Неработающие компьютеры и все, что с ними связано.
Ответить

Пишу статью о патче BIOS

Сб сен 11, 2021 11:47:13

BIOS Подробно.zip
(13.95 KiB) Скачиваний: 130


Продолжать? Ваше мнение?

Re: Пишу статью о патче BIOS

Сб сен 11, 2021 11:58:23

коты биловские доки не читают тем пачен перепакованые оно надо камуто распаковывать и ставить дохуягибабайтныйсофт ради ВАС
преводи в PDF сразу тогда есть шанс что прочтут...

Re: Пишу статью о патче BIOS

Сб сен 11, 2021 12:05:45

MsWord редкая трудно доставаемая прога?

Добавлено after 1 minute 8 seconds:
Вообще, пишу для себя, так-что, если никто не спросит мне плевать.

Re: Пишу статью о патче BIOS

Сб сен 11, 2021 12:16:25

Гениально!
Пишите ,я буду вас читать...и даже цитировать!

Re: Пишу статью о патче BIOS

Сб сен 11, 2021 13:13:42

Далее будет о добавлении в BIOS микрокодов для поддержки не поддерживаемых изначально процессоров.
BIOS Подробно.zip
(20.46 KiB) Скачиваний: 114


Добавлено after 5 minutes 18 seconds:
Микрокоды будем добавлять в BIOS от AWARD. Потому большинство статей посвящено AMI BIOS, так как для нее есть развитые средства редактирования. Для AWARD есть cbrom602b.exe с интерфейсом только командной строки. Поэтому будем писать скрипт.

Добавлено after 1 minute 55 seconds:
Вот что выдал cbrom602b, последней строки (16) изначально не было, она добавлена.

CBROM V6.02B (C)Award Software 1999 All Rights Reserved.

******** 5epa4MOD.BIN BIOS component ********

No. Item-Name Original-Size Compressed-Size Original-File-Name
======== 0. System BIOS 20000h(128.00K)145B4h(81.43K)5epa4C22.BIN
1. XGROUP CODE 0E180h(56.38K)0998Fh(38.39K)awardext.rom
2. ACPI table 0482Eh(18.04K)01B34h(6.80K)ACPITBL.BIN
3. YGROUP ROM 0F9B0h(62.42K)04ABCh(18.68K)awardeyt.rom
4. Other(4029:0000) 04790h(17.89K)0200Dh(8.01K)_EN_CODE.BIN
5. Other(4026:0000) 0AC8Dh(43.14K)05DBDh(23.43K)AWDFLASH.EXE
6. PCI driver[A] 0F800h(62.00K)088F5h(34.24K)YukPXE.LOM
7. PCI driver[B] 0E600h(57.50K)08BBBh(34.93K)RAID_OR.BIN
8. LOGO BitMap 4B30Ch(300.76K)0689Bh(26.15K)5epaP.bmp
9. PCI driver[C] 0A800h(42.00K)05F52h(23.83K)ite8212.181
10. EPA pattern 01964h(6.35K)00628h(1.54K)64N4IIP.BMP
11. EPA1 ROM 019A0h(6.41K)009B7h(2.43K)64N4P4P.BMP
12. Other(401A:0000) 019A0h(6.41K)00952h(2.33K)64N4P4HT.BMP
13. Other(401B:0000) 01B94h(6.89K)00954h(2.33K)64N4P4E.BMP
14. Other(401C:0000) 01B94h(6.89K)00A29h(2.54K)64N4P4HE.BMP
15. Other(401D:0000) 019A0h(6.41K)007F3h(1.99K)64N4ICPD.BMP
16. CPU micro code 0A000h(40.00K)089B1h(34.42K)ncpucode.bin

Total compress code space = 16000h(472.00K)
Total compressed code size = 55DECh(343.48K)
Remain compress code space = 00214h(128.52K)

Добавлено after 4 minutes 33 seconds:
Но, самое интересное, когда мы перейдем от добавления процессоров к патчу ШИН FWH, PCI и PCIE, а также ISA.
Последний раз редактировалось astrahard Вс сен 12, 2021 05:23:57, всего редактировалось 1 раз.

Re: Пишу статью о патче BIOS

Сб сен 11, 2021 15:19:28

Если оно поможет в UEFI Z77A-G43 отключить загрузку с USB принтера, то почитаю. Если не поможет то бесполезно.
Ну так что поможет не искать загрузочный сектор на принтере?

Re: Пишу статью о патче BIOS

Сб сен 11, 2021 17:49:00

неа....толка полное легаси офф

Re: Пишу статью о патче BIOS

Сб сен 11, 2021 17:59:32

легаси офф, классно сформулировано. К этому и стремлюсь. Конечно, не в полном объеме.

Re: Пишу статью о патче BIOS

Вс сен 12, 2021 08:36:56

Суть в том что на дорогих платах биос сильно урезан и раздут, нет большинства функций которые есть на офисных платах. так что возможно в этом направлении имеет смысл модифицировать.
На моей плате невозможно использовать не uefi режим загрузки, других вариантов просто нет. Ну точнее есть ещё исключительно uefi игнорируя другие, что никак не лучше.
Размер видеопамяти для встройки тоже очень сильно урезан, в 4 раза по сравнению с более дешёвой и старой платой, офисные платы на встройке более игровые.

Хотелось бы думать будущее за опенсорсным биосом, но у биоса нет будущего, на арме его нет, он остался только на огрызках, ну и на росийских спарках

Re: Пишу статью о патче BIOS

Вс сен 12, 2021 12:17:21

74LS00, вам следовало знать что от того что BIOS обозвали в новых мамахах ка uefi он не перестал по сути быть BIOS!
да там появились специфические модули подержки новых серийCPU 9 встроеного видеоядра GPU_CPU
b ряда друхих фич +добавлена графика и работа с мыщой ...в обшем это ка замена дос форточками... и это уже 2 попытка когда вышла вин95 AMI сотворила WINBIOS.... не прижился ... главная причина подержка мыша была хреновой работали тока 2 вида не популярных мышей не жениус не логитех ни А4Т не подеоржаны...и главный минус утилит для работы с этими версиями таки не было.. а подержки болших винтоф винтоф и работы с USB легаси исходно незаложили

Добавлено after 7 minutes 4 seconds:
но сейчас порлно жирных altitr а с переходом на spi flash все силно упростилось эти флехи дешевы легко паяются прогер для них простой
+не забывайте в uefi добавлен модули для ключей ОС например часто там зашит ключ винды привязаный к конкретной мамке тамже в отделном разделе современый софт прописывет свои ID(по сути софт эмул HASP) что ползволяет при переустановке автоподхватывать регистрацию и привязку того софта

Re: Пишу статью о патче BIOS

Пн сен 13, 2021 01:37:29

Расшифровал содержимое микро кодов для самых вкусных процессоров (E5500 выпущен на два года позже E7500) вот и думайте E5500 это Dual Core или Core Duo ?
Ох уж это МАРХЕТОЛОГИ

ntel Microcode List ver0.4a

CPUID=6F2 Rev=5D 2010/10/02 CRC=9384A573 Off=0 Size=1000 Plat=0 Core 2 Duo E4300
CPUID=6F6 Rev=D0 2010/09/30 CRC=B61EC71A Off=1000 Size=1000 Plat=0 Core 2 Duo E6400
CPUID=6F7 Rev=6A 2010/10/02 CRC=9911AAF2 Off=2000 Size=1000 Plat=4 Intel Xeon X3220
CPUID=6FB Rev=BA 2010/10/03 CRC=08707B60 Off=3000 Size=1000 Plat=0 Core 2 Quad Q6600
CPUID=6FB Rev=BA 2010/10/03 CRC=ED247070 Off=4000 Size=1000 Plat=4 Core 2 Quad Q6600
CPUID=6FD Rev=A4 2010/10/02 CRC=9ACE6116 Off=5000 Size=1000 Plat=0 Intel Pentium E2180
CPUID=10676 Rev=612 2015/08/02 CRC=1750A2A6 Off=6000 Size=1000 Plat=0,4,7 Intel Xeon E5440
CPUID=10677 Rev=70D 2015/08/02 CRC=DAE8586D Off=7000 Size=1000 Plat=4 Core 2 Quad Q9550
CPUID=1067A Rev=A0E 2015/07/29 CRC=59BF808E Off=8000 Size=2000 Plat=0,4,5,7 Intel Pentium E5500
Ответить